Hole in one quest continues....

played a shorter course today, lots of par 3's, our foursome was playing a scramble, me and my grandpa against my uncle and dad,
my irons were great today on the back nine and i had several close calls,

#10, short par 3 about 107 yards, took out a gap wedge and hardly swang.... sooring ball flight, dead straight, about as it reaches its apex i say "get in" it comes down and nails the pin and stops dead about 3 inches away, probably the closest i've ever been,

#14, nother short par 3 about 120, i pull out a pitching wedge and kinda hit it off the toe, but it draws back and goes straight over the flag and sticks about 5 ft. my grandpa (partner) put his to three ft on a great shot,

#16 longer par 3 about 150 yards, downhill off the face of a dam, i hit a soaring 7 iron with a nice 1 yard draw, takes forever to come down and hits about 6 inches from the pin, but due to the slanting green we hit into it rolls back to about 10 ft.


our team ended up shooting -3 for an easy win,


at this rate one has to go in sometime...... i can just feel it coming soon, i'm so close and i really think my game has advanced in the last two weeks or so , i know so much more about my game than i had before,

Here's the opposite point of view...

My last league night before vaca I hit a nice 4 iron into a par 3. The guys on the team we were playing were sure it was in the hole. We couldn't really tell for certain since the hole was playing about 200 yards and the green was elevated.

While walking up to the green, I kept saying to myself - "Please don't be in, Please don't be in..." There are 48 two man teams in our league and an ace would have cost me somewhere in the $200 range.

As it turned out the pin was way in the back and I was a good 12 feet short, but from the tee, I was a tiny bit nervous. Hopefully you're first ace will come with only a few people in the bar

PS - I paid my buck later that day for the member insurance "just in case"
